Article Marketing

Article Marketing is still a good way to get targeted traffic.
Simply because someone has to actually read your article then click on the link to visit your site. If they’ve read your article, they know what your site is about and they are not going to click your link unless they are interested in more info.
So you write an article, based around the subject of your site and submit it to article directories . . . free
There you go. Yes, article marketing is that simple. Well, almost.
Firstly, the article must be written around a keyword related to the content on your site, so both the search engines and real people can find it.
So if your keyword was weight loss tips for example, your article could be:
“5 weight loss tips to lose 2lbs this week”  “3 fast weight loss tips” “Weight loss tips for painless slimming”
Within the article you can refer to a product or products which you have for sale on your site. Maybe include a comparison of products for different fitness goals, a review of a best selling product, info on various effective diets which are helped by your products or an article on the fitness benefits of different nutrient, which are obviously available in various formulas on your site.
Obviously these are just examples. So long as your article is written about something to do with the subject of your site, and it’s useful to visitors who are interested in the subject, go for it.
Always use your keyword in the title of your article and a couple of times throughout the article.
You’ll automatically be including other related keywords as you write about the subject, which is good as the search engines like to see related keywords.
It’s so easy now to research anything online. Visit other weight loss sites, check out the article sites and you’ll have lots of info you can re-write to form your own article.
Massive Tip Do a little research on what other people are writing about in your niche. Go to ezinearticle.com and research other articles in your niche. It can be a great source of ideas.

Your article’s purpose is to get people interested in visiting your site. If you sound like you know what you’re talking about and have useful and interesting content, people are more likely to click through.
Good articles relate to the content of your website and entice the reader to the resource box which would contain a ‘call to action’ and a link to your site.
The call to action is simply the end of the article, written in a way to encourage the reader to click and visit your site.

As each link to your site within the article is classed as a backlink to your site by the search engines, the links will show the search engines your site is popular and so they will rank you higher.
Also, human visitors can click on the link once they have read the article and come to your site.

Your Author Bio Box or Author Signature as it’s called is simple the bit at the bottom of the article. Sometimes it’s simply the last paragraph of the article and sometimes it’s in a separate box at the bottom.
It depends on the website you are submitting the article to. They can be a little different.   Example Author Box  
A great way to increase your click throughs is to have a ‘call to action’ at the end of your article in your author signature, as in the above example.

Remember that for articles you post, or indeed any content you put on any of the above sites, each post will have 2 purposes:
 SEO/Backlink: To act as a backlink, telling the search engines that you have another site linking to yours, to prove your site’s popularity. Long term and with enough backlinks, your site will rise in the search engine results.
 A source of visitors to your site: To act as bait for potential visitors. They will be searching for info, see your article, read it and hopefully click on the link to your site for more info.
The other good thing about article sites is that other website owners can use the articles on their own site. As long as they leave the author box intact.
Many other website owners, ezine and newsletter editors will search the main article directories for suitable articles to use as content. And as your author signature box will still be included when they put the article on their site . . . more traffic for you.
You can try writing fewer, very high quality articles and posting them to let’s say just ezinearticles.com. As it’s classed as number one in the eyes of many marketers.
Or you can write lots of articles or have them written for you, and post them to as many article directories as possible.
The best option would be to send your original articles to ezinearticles.com, then re-write them and send them out to various other article directories. Make sure the original is accepted by ezine first.

There are tools available online to speed up your article marketing efforts:
Article submission software: You load up an article or articles and the software has a list of article directories where it automatically posts your article. Very good for time saving and getting your article out to many sites quickly.
Article spinning software: Load your article into this software and it will re-write it. (also called spinning) Many of the article submission software program have built in spinners.

Write 300 to 500 word articles based around your keywords. Your articles should be useful to readers. Solve a problem, give great info/advice or give 10 best tips, etc. Make sure there’s a benefit in the title.
 Make sure you include your keyword at the beginning of the title of the article. Also use your keyword in the first paragraph of your article and sprinkle it throughout the rest.
 Use your Author Signature wisely to sell yourself by offering more info and advice via a link to your website.
 Write and submit as many articles as possible. Relating to as many of your keywords as possible. And do it regularly.
 When you feel ready, you can also put some of your articles on your site as content and submit different articles to the article directories.
 Concentrate on feeding articles regularly to the top directories like Ezinearticles.com.
